Factors Affecting Cost
Installing a plastic downspout in Edgewater, MD, involves selecting appropriate materials and ensuring proper installation to direct rainwater away from the building foundation.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ners estimate costs and compare options effectively.
- Materials: Usually made from durable PVC or polyethylene, available in various colors to match existing gutters and exterior finishes.
- Size and Scope: Commonly installed in 2x3 inch or 3x4 inch dimensions, depending on the roof size and drainage needs.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ves attaching downspouts to gutters and directing them away from the foundation, typically requiring basic carpentry and plumbing skills.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Edgewater may require permits for certain drainage modifications; it's advisable to check with local authorities before beginning work.
- Extras: Additional components such as elbows, splash blocks, or extensions may be included to improve water flow and protect landscaping.
